Each review score is between 1-10. To get the overall score that you see, we add up all the review scores we’ve received and divide that total by the number of review scores we’ve received. We are currently testing a weighted review system in Malta and Iceland (excluding hotel and vacation rental chains). For properties in these countries, the more recent the review, the bigger the impact on the total review score calculation. In addition, guests can give separate ‘subscores’ in crucial areas, such as location, cleanliness, staff, comfort, facilities, value for money and free Wi-Fi. Note that guests submit their subscores and their overall scores independently, so there’s no direct link between them.

United KingdomWe needed a stopover after a late night ferry landing from Ireland. We received very helpful and prompt communication from Steve at the hostel in advance, assuring us that he would wait up to see to our arrival. He even found a parking spot for our car plus bike carrier - better, more personal service than we've had in pricier hotels. Comfortable room, comfy bed, thoughtfully equipped (hair dryer, toiletries) and great original artwork on the walls throughout. We were delighted to find in the morning that not only were tea and coffee included, but also cereals including gluten free cornflakes. Nice little kitchen well equipped with pots, pans etc. Friendly place altogether, in a lovingly restored old school building with a stunning main room. Great value too. We will definitely recommend, and will be back.
